Board awards bids for office renovation and moves $50,000 to stadium capital; staff to return with quotes

Lincoln County Board of Education · May 14, 2026

Trustees approved bids for board office painting and flooring, asked staff to price access-control/security separately, and moved $50,000 into the capital fund to begin repairs at Lar Campbell Stadium, with trustees noting more funds may be required.

The board approved bids to refresh the central office and authorized an initial capital transfer to begin work at Lar Campbell Stadium.

Staff recommended awarding the painting contract to Lonnie Blackwell (lowest bid) and an LVP/flooring contract to Lively's Flooring; trustees approved those bidders. Trustees asked for a cost breakout for access control and interior cameras after staff referenced an approximately $30,000 security quote. The board directed staff to return with the access‑control price separated from renovation bids.

On stadium needs, trustees described rusting perimeter fencing, locker room and restroom concerns, and agreed that fence repairs would likely have the greatest immediate visual impact. The board voted to transfer $50,000 into the capital fund for initial stadium work and asked staff to collect quotes and return with a recommended scope and budget.
